Japan Probe brings us a couple of videos from Kelly Osbourne’s new show ‘Turning Japanese’. Its your basic reality show where she goes to some exotic place and experiences the quirks of a foreign culture. But damn, I think Japan was a bit too much even for the daughter of the king of metal.

Culture shock doesn’t get much more literal than this, in the first video we see Kelly working at a maid cafe, pretty easy and standard stuff. Save for not knowing much Japanese at all she does ok, after that we see her trying to manage a love hotel for some hours, its funny, yet I feel a little bit sorry, I don’t know if I feel sorry for Kelly or for Japan though. In the end, I don’t think it matters.
